Dale Earnhardt Jr. To Make Appearance In Martinsville Speedway Fan Zone
By Chad Hall Saturday, July 17, 2010 12:00 AM :: 18 Views :: News Events
 

MARTINSVILLE, VA (July 16, 2010) – AMP Energy driver Dale Earnhardt Jr. will take time to visit with fans and answer some of their questions before the TUMS Fast Relief 500 at Martinsville Speedway on October 24.

Earnhardt will make an appearance in the Martinsville Speedway Fan Zone sponsored by AMP Energy just a couple of hours before the start of the TUMS Fast Relief 500, the sixth race in the Chase for the Sprint Cup.

“We always feel fortunate when we get Dale Jr. for our Fan Zone. Obviously the fans love him and he does such a great job in the question-and-answer session,” said Martinsville Speedway President W. Clay Campbell. “He makes them feel very at ease, he’s got a great sense of humor talking with them and he provides a lot of information.”

Earnhardt’s appearance will be an emceed question and answer session. There will not be any autograph sessions.

Admission to the Martinsville Speedway Fan Zone sponsored by AMP Energy is $99 and includes pastries, juice and coffee for breakfast, lunch buffet, four beverage coupons for Pepsi products, AMP Energy drinks and beer (Patrons 21 and older). It also includes a Pre-Race Track Pass.

The Pre-Race Track Pass allows fans to stroll on the track along the frontstretch from 9:00 a.m. to noon.

The $99 price does not include a ticket to the TUMS Fast Relief 500.

The Martinsville Speedway Fan Zone will open at 8 a.m. on October 24.

The pastries will be served at 8 a.m. with the lunch buffet beginning at 10:30 am.
